Husse

Re: Video Problem-Picture delay

Post by Husse »

I'm not sure how much hardware contributes here, but if there is decoding to be done it does.
You have a somewhat aging hardware and ATI does not support the Radeon 9600 any more. Do you have two Radeon 9600?
If not the fact that it appears twice may explain the situation
I have seen very few (or none) cases like this so my experience is limited and I wasn't helped much by google
Oh - is this with every player?
In mplayer it could be worthwhile to set audio to alsa and video to X11
